Kachumber - Fresh Tomato, Cucumber, and Onion Relish

Recipe #81282 | 15 min | 15 min prep | add private note
Sue L

By: Sue L
Jan 16, 2004

A spicy tomato, cucumber and onion relish that is a refreshing accompaniment to most Indian meals. I like it a bit on the spicy side, but you can adjust the amount of peppers to your own taste.

SERVES 5 -6 (change servings and units)

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    Combine all ingredients, mixing well.
  2. 2
    Serve chilled.
  3. 3
    Goes well with spicy curries.
